Working on an Offshore Rig

A person working on a rig offshore enjoys a life style that is different from the typical person who lives on land. Being on a platform or rig can be a lucrative career, but it also has some serious drawbacks. These drawbacks are often due to the long hours and harsh conditions that workers will be confronted with.

Offshore  offshore company consultant , which are massive structures that are built in the ocean are used to drill for natural gas and oil. They also collect petroleum products that are sucked up from the seabed. A mobile drilling unit (MODU) may be used to dig the well and a production rig for pumping. The production rig is usually larger than the drilling rig and is designed to extract the oil from the ocean floor rather than to dig more wells.  offshore consulting company  are equipped with living quarters, helicopter pads and escape boats for crews.

offshore consultancy company  are also outfitted with the equipment and tools needed to drill and extract oil. Pipelines are usually constructed from the rig down to the seabed, and then back up again. The rigs are equipped with drilling tools as well as a hoisting mechanism that can raise and lower the drilling pipe. The rigs also come with a Blow Out Preventer stack, which can be used to seal an oil well in case of blowouts.

In addition to working on the rigs, they are many other opportunities on an offshore platform. These are typically entry-level positions like roustabouts and cooks. Some companies offer on-the-job training for new employees, so they can gain experience before advancing to more professional positions.

The majority of people working on an offshore rig have a lot of work to do and the hours are long and exhausting. There are few vacations and very little time to get acquainted with other crew members. The rigs are on the open sea and can be hundreds of miles from shore, and so transportation between and to work must be arranged. Helicopters are the primary method of transport, but there are also vessels for crews.

Working on the development of a Land Based Rig

Land-based rigs are also used to drill holes in order to locate oil underground. They are able to be small and portable similar to the ones used in mineral exploration drilling, or huge capable of drilling thousands of feet below surface of the earth. They can be powered by electrical, mechanical, hydraulic, or pneumatic power. It depends on the location and what kind of oil well is being drilling.

While working on a land-based equipment may not be as hazardous as offshore work, there are many dangers involved with this type of work. Working on drilling rigs requires you have a high-school diploma, a good physical condition, CPR and first aid certifications, and training to handle dangerous materials. Depending on the material with which you work, you may require HAZMAT certification and a permit to drive to and from the rig.

Offshore installations are structures built on the seabed for the purpose of building and maintaining offshore oil or gas facilities. They include oil platforms and wind turbines as well drilling production facilities and rigs. Offshore structures are transported in a variety of ways based on their size and type. They can be built onshore, transported and then installed on the site, or constructed on the site.

The installation and transportation of offshore structures can be extremely expensive and therefore, most employers require employees to complete the safety course called Basic Offshore Induction and Emergency Training (BOSIET). This is a must for anyone who wishes to work on an offshore structure. It is designed to protect the safety and health of the employees, and the other people who live within the structure.

The most common entry-level job on a rig is as a roustabout or general maintenance worker. After gaining some experience and presenting a positive impression on the rig's management, it is possible to be promoted to a roughneck within one year. Roughnecks carry out a variety of duties on the rig, such as building and maintaining equipment. They also are responsible for operating and observing the drills used to extract oil.

There are many other positions on an offshore rig including engineers, geologists and chemical engineers. Certain of these positions are extremely specialized and require a bachelor's degree or higher. Find out the education and training needed for a particular job.

Aside from the oil and gas companies, the offshore sector comprises thousands of other companies. They include geophysical companies transportation services, steel fabricators as well as helicopter and marine transportation, ROV manufacturers welders, computer and AI specialists, and engineering companies.
